Many industrial exporters equate "multilingual support" with SEO success, falling into a severe cognitive trap. EasyYard's Q3 2025 global site health scan shows 68% of B2B sites suffer "pseudo-multilingual" issues: chaotic URL structures (e.g., mixing /en/ and /uk/), 73% missing hreflang tags, and core product pages failing to localize search terms (e.g., German clients search "Schwerlastfahrzeug" rather than literal "heavy duty vehicle" translations). Crucially, manual translations cannot preserve industry jargon contexts—"axle load capacity" must emphasize compliance certification in Southeast Asia but desert operation adaptability in the Middle East. These semantic fractures cause 41% CTR drops and 79% bounce rate spikes in Google organic traffic.

When SEO teams obsess over rankings while SEM teams chase CPC—without shared user journey mapping—B2B sites become "dual-track disconnected" marketing black holes. EasyYard's 2026 data shows 52% of enterprises still treat SEO/SEM as separate modules, causing three fatal wastes: brand term ad budgets cannibalized by organic search without synergy; high-intent long-tail terms face SEM bidding wars while SEO content lags; complete LinkedIn ad→site visit→PDF download→form submission chains lose attribution from inconsistent UTM parameters.

Many export teams still apply B2C-style FB ads: relying on broad interest tags (e.g., "logistics"), generic creatives, and ignoring LinkedIn-FB user portrait gaps. Results speak clearly—CTRs stagnate below 0.8%, CPL exceeds $120, and 83% form submitters lack purchasing authority. The root issue? B2B decisions involve procurement managers, CTOs, and CFOs—single ads cannot cover all touchpoints.

When CEOs ask "Our $2M Q2 overseas marketing spend—how many real orders resulted?" and teams answer "~30 leads," it reveals fatal attribution blind spots. Most lack end-to-end tracking from ad clicks→site behavior→CRM leads→sales stages→orders—especially for heavy vehicles where factory visits and contract negotiations defy traditional GA4 models.
